1. Introduction The ocean is an acoustic wave-guide limited above by the sea surface and below by the seafloor. In the acoustic viewpoints, the sea is extremely variable. The sea current, internal wave, mesoscale eddy, etc. all disturb the sound propagation. The mesoscale eddy is frequently seen in places close to the strong peak front current.
